## Further reading

This covers the basics of Wayfinder, our mobile deep-link routing layer. Routes are declared in the shared manifest, resolved at app launch, and fall back to the web target when a screen is unavailable. Deferred links and attribution params are handled by the Linkshed middleware, not here. For routing precedence rules, the migration plan off legacy URI schemes, and open questions flagged at last week's sync, see the internal page.

runbook for baguf-bawip: https://jira.qorvelsys.internal/pages/pages/pages/browse/1853

## Report Builder: Sort Stability

Tallygrid's report builder uses a non-stable quicksort by default. Multi-column sorts must apply keys in reverse order or rows with equal primary keys will shuffle between runs. If a customer reports nondeterministic ordering, check the `stable_sort` flag first. Reproduce locally against the Millbrook staging dataset before patching. Pulling that dataset requires hitting the internal fixtures service, which authenticates per request. Use the key below for fixture access.

service key, yadug-bajog: zpat3_pou

2025-02-14 — Rotated credentials for the Marrowgate partner SFTP drop. The previous keypair had exceeded our ninety-day rotation window, and the nightly reconciliation feed from the Ostrand partners was the only consumer still on it. All upload scripts in the drop-runner repo have been updated, the old key has been revoked on both endpoints, and a dry-run transfer completed cleanly. Release managers should confirm that the next scheduled drop authenticates using the key that follows.

release key, fahaf-bajof: bky3_Xam

TURN-208: Gatevale turnstile counters at the Merrow Field pilot double-count when a rotation reverses mid-cycle. Attendance totals drift roughly 2% high per event. The debounce window fix is implemented, reviewed by Ilsa, and soak-tested across two simulated match days without drift. Ready for your cut; the candidate build is identified below.

trace token, tagag-tafog: htk6_5ed18c